      • A tech CEO died following a fall at a company event in India, multiple outlets reported. Vistex CEO Sanjay Shah and the firm's president, Vishwanath Raju Datla, were being lowered onto a stage in an iron cage designed to look like the gondola of a hot-air balloon when a cable appeared to snap, a video posted by The Times of India showed.
